FIRST ON FOX: DOJ Sues Spanberger’s Virginia Over Federal Agent Mask Ban, ICE Laws
The DOJ highlighted that federal officers found in violation of Virginia’s new mask and identification law could face a Class 1 misdemeanor, which carries potential penalties of up to 12 months in jail, a fine of up to $2,500, or both, under Virginia law.
The federal lawsuit names Virginia Attorney General Jay Jones and Fairfax County Commonwealth Attorney Steve Descano as defendants. Descano has previously received backing from groups linked to George Soros.
